Job Title: Network Security Solution Architect
Corporate Title: Assistant Vice President
Location: New York, NY or Cary, North Carolina
This role is part of the global Chief Security Office (CSO) team based in New York. You will be responsible for designing and engineering network security solutions delivered by the CSO Chief Technology Officer (CTO). Your responsibilities include the design, implementation, and maintenance of the Bank's network security infrastructure, including evaluation, development, and implementation of security tooling and controls. You will collaborate closely with stakeholders across networks, operations, architecture, and production support functions.
